About the Role
\nAs the Project Coordinator, you'll play a key role in supporting project delivery, governance and reporting across a range of infrastructure initiatives. You'll work closely with project managers and stakeholders to ensure projects remain organised, on schedule and well communicated.
\nYour responsibilities will include:
\n- \n
- Coordinating multiple infrastructure projects and initiatives \n
- Preparing project documentation, reports and executive updates \n
- Maintaining project schedules, action registers and governance documentation \n
- Coordinating project meetings, preparing agendas and taking minutes \n
- Tracking project milestones, risks, issues and deliverables \n
- Supporting project reporting through project management systems \n
- Assisting with continuous improvement initiatives and project planning \n
- Liaising with a wide range of internal and external stakeholders \n
- Providing high-level administrative support to senior management and project teams \n
- Maintaining accurate project records and ensuring documentation is current \n
